Welcome to the Community Music Program—where you or your child will study with remarkable artists and faculty. Our instructors are drawn from the best professional music organizations in northeast Ohio.
The Community Music Program offers private instrument and voice instruction for youth ages 10 and over through adults. Lessons are available in 12-week sessions during the academic year and in 6-week sessions during the late spring and summer.

Choose from 30-, 45-, and 60-minute weekly lessons.
Lessons are held in Cleveland State 's beautiful Music and Communication Building. It's located between East 18th and East 21st streets on Euclid Avenue. The campus is served by public transportation, or convenient parking is available for an additional fee.
